Job Summary The Credit and Collections Specialist is responsible for evaluating customer creditworthiness, monitoring outstanding accounts, and ensuring timely collection of payments. This role helps protect the company’s financial health by minimizing credit risk, reducing delinquent accounts, and maintaining positive customer relationships.

Essential Functions

Monitor accounts receivable aging reports and follow up on past-due invoices.

Contact customers via phone, email, and written communication to resolve outstanding balances.

Negotiate payment plans, settlements, or revised terms when necessary.

Record all collection activities and maintain accurate notes and documentation.

Investigate and resolve billing discrepancies, short-payments, and account issues.

Collaborate with sales, customer service, and billing teams to ensure accurate invoicing and smooth account management.

Provide customers with copies of invoices, statements, and supporting documents.

Prepare weekly/monthly aging and collection performance reports.

Escalate high-risk or severely delinquent accounts to the Credit Account Manager.

Ensure compliance with company policies, credit regulations, and industry best practices.

Perform other duties as assigned.
